diff options
| author | Nathan Perry <np@nathanperry.dev> | 2020-06-20 16:17:05 -0400 |
|---|---|---|
| committer | Nathan Perry <np@nathanperry.dev> | 2020-06-20 16:17:05 -0400 |
| commit | 16e660f5cd3787e587a5d082f57ab9d900aee0ca (patch) | |
| tree | b6d67d820f2342f42f2dae00318f416d8a6142f9 /src/audio/play_queue.rs | |
| parent | 7cd17b04f7422dcce1410ec26922cba161cd6e0d (diff) | |
move configuration into envconfig
Diffstat (limited to 'src/audio/play_queue.rs')
| -rw-r--r-- | src/audio/play_queue.rs |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/src/audio/play_queue.rs b/src/audio/play_queue.rs index 6026587..e2d4468 100644 --- a/src/audio/play_queue.rs +++ b/src/audio/play_queue.rs @@ -30,9 +30,8 @@ use crate::{ commands::{ sound_levels::DEFAULT_VOLUME, }, - must_env_lookup, Result, - TARGET_GUILD_ID, + CONFIG, }; const SECONDS_LEAD_TIME: f32 = 0.75; @@ -115,7 +114,7 @@ impl PlayQueue { queue.playing = None; let mut manager = voice_manager.lock(); - manager.leave(*TARGET_GUILD_ID); + manager.leave(CONFIG.discord.guild()); debug!("disconnected because playback finished"); } @@ -228,7 +227,7 @@ impl PlayQueue { }; let mut manager = voice_manager.lock(); - let handler = manager.join(*TARGET_GUILD_ID, must_env_lookup::<u64>("VOICE_CHANNEL")); + let handler = manager.join(CONFIG.discord.guild(), CONFIG.discord.voice_channel()); match handler { Some(handler) => { |
